Die Tage fiel mir auf, dass meine Inbox verdächtig leer ist. Irgendwie fehlen die Mails, dir mir mein Blog so zu schicken pflegt, um neue Kommentare anzukündigen. Strange. Kurzes googeln brachte die Erleuchtung: Goneo hat neulich etwas an seinen Servern gedreht und die Policy für die mail()-Funktion geändert. Suuuuupi… (Vielleicht sollte ich den blöden Newsletter doch wieder abonnieren, um solche Ding nicht erst 2 Wochen später zu erfahren?)
Aus der Zeit in der ich noch auf Free-Hosting setzte, weiß ich, dass es gegen das mail()-Problem ein nettes Plugin für WordPress gibt. Das Plugin bringt WordPress bei SMTP zu sprechen. D.h. man ist nicht mehr auf die mail()-Funktion vom Server angewiesen, sondern kann jeden x-beliebigen SMTP-Server verwenden, um WordPress Mails schicken zu lassen. Das Plugin nennt sich WP-Mail-SMTP und kann bequem über den WP Plugin Installer bezogen und installiert werden.
Die ganz natürliche Idee ist nun den Goneo SMTP-Server zu verwenden und dem Plugin die Login-Informationen zu einem Mailkonto zu füttern. Gedacht – getan. Pustekuchen. Das Mail-Plugin sagt zwar brav, dass eine Verbindung zum SMTP-Server aufgebaut und die Mail übergeben wurde, es kommen halt leider keine Mails an (oder zumindest brauchen das länger als ich bislang gewartet habe (= 30 Minuten (= viel zu lange!))). Aber wie gesagt: man kann ja jeden x-beliebigen SMTP-Server einstellen…
Eh voila: WordPress mailt wieder.
Nachtrag: Eben noch geprüft: auch der Versand des automatischen Datenbank-Backups funktioniert über das SMTP-Plugin. Klasse!
Ein weiterer Trick ist das ablegen einer Php.ini im WordPress Verzeichnis. Näheres dazu hier: http://wiki.goneo.de/doku.php?id=mailversand_php
Funktioniert auch ganz gut und auch zeitnaher.
Gruß
Thomas
Danke für den Tipp. Werde das mal testen!
Grüße!
Holger
Kann es sein das mein längerer Kommentar zum Thema Lifestreaming deshalb nicht ankam? Eigentlich unlogisch, aber ich habs über 2 Tage immer wieder versucht und er kam nie an.
Es reicht wenn du die vier Einträge in der
class-phpmailer.php im Ordner wp-includes anpasst.
Zeile 471-488.
An jede Zeile mit dem @mail musst du am Ende
, “-f muss-existieren@ihre-domain-bei-goneo.de”
vor der Schlussklammer einfügen. Als Email musst du eine für deine domain erstelle Emaildresse einsetzten.
Vielleicht schreibt jemand dafür ein Plugin.
Gruß
Hallo
Ich verwende WP-Mail-SMTP und Contact Form 7
Contact Form 7 versendet aber nur Mails wenn der Absender eine Geneo Adresse ist ?
Hat jemand das selbe Problem?
Ja, hier ich auch.
Ich versuch mich grad mit der php.ini
ABER: ich hab kein plan, WAS in der PHP.ini stehen muss.
NOCH
weiss ich in welche ordner ich das alles kopieren soll!
Kann ich dir auch nicht sagen. Ich habe einfach das Plugin für SMTP genommen, weil ich keine Lust hatte da ewig viel Zeit mit tot zu schlagen
Es gibt aber in der Anleitung von Goneo diese beiden Artikel, die helfen könnten:
http://wiki.goneo.de/doku.php?id=mailversand_php
http://wiki.goneo.de/doku.php?id=php.ini